Output 6d99404bc18bddf0e7cb678b18c186719a6844bb666da1a8dd69ae91fb5d0979:0

value
6978336549858
script pubkey
OP_0 OP_PUSHBYTES_20 e8cc788f3075658e334168adaef6c01110c9e07a
address
tb1qarx83resw4jcuv6pdzk6aakqzygvncr6hm2lu9
transaction
6d99404bc18bddf0e7cb678b18c186719a6844bb666da1a8dd69ae91fb5d0979
confirmations
189318
spent
true